| Family | ASTERACEAE |
| Genus species | Cousinia eleonorae Hub.-Mor. trib. Cardueae |
| Bibliography | Notes Roy. Bot. Gard. Edinburgh 32: 50 (1972) |
| Native Range | c. Turkey |
| Primary Biome | Temperate |
| Habitat | stony grassland |
| Altitude | 1400-1600m |
| Description | thinly white tomentose, basal leaves oblong, 5-10cm long, pinnatipartite, segments narrow, capitula ca. 12mm long |
| Size | 10-15cm |
| Color | red, yellow |
| Bloom | summer |
| Ca | + |
| Type | perennial |
| Cultivation | sunny site with a deep, drained soil alpine house, rich, drained soil, sun |
| Propagation | seed in spring, germ. 1 month, 13-18°C division in early spring and fall; cuttings in late summer |
| Territory | 3 Asia-Temperate 34 Western Asia (TUR Turkey) |
